Jordan Brod is the Agency Operations Manager for the Texas A&M Veterinary Medical Diagnostic Laboratory (TVMDL). He has served in this role since October 2010 and functions as the agency’s liaison for building projects, coordinating with vendors and maintenance personnel for the maintenance and support of TVMDL facilities located in College Station, Amarillo, Center and Gonzales. He chairs the TVMDL Safety Committee and ensures development, implementation, and continual improvement of environmental health, safety, containment, and biosecurity programs. In 2005, Jordan joined the American Association of Veterinary Laboratory Diagnosticians (AAVLD) and its Quality Assurance Committee where he continues active membership. In February 2011, Jordan was selected by the AAVLD Accreditation Committee as a site-visit auditor. He also serves on the TVMDL Quality Assurance and the Quality System Management Review committees. He co-chaired the TVMDL Employee Advisory Council in 2009 and 2010.

Jordan has received several TVMDL awards including the 2009 Director’s Excellence Award, the 2005 and 2007 Director’s Service Awards, and was named Employee of the Year in 2000 and 2006. Jordan is a 2000 graduate of Texas A&M University with a B.S. in Animal Science. Prior to his current position, Jordan advanced through the Histopathology and Quality Assurance departments of TVMDL, moving from laboratory technician to supervisor to Quality Assurance & Safety Manager; serving in these various roles from 1999 to 2010. Jordan and his wife, Christie, reside in College Station with their two children.
